what is an equation of the line that passes through the point (2, 5) and is parallel to the line x - 2y = 6?

Explanation:

Step1: Find slope of given line

Rewrite \(x - 2y = 6\) in slope - intercept form \(y=mx + b\) (where \(m\) is slope).
Subtract \(x\) from both sides: \(-2y=-x + 6\).
Divide by \(-2\): \(y=\frac{1}{2}x-3\). So slope \(m = \frac{1}{2}\).

Step2: Use point - slope form for parallel line

Parallel lines have equal slopes, so new line has \(m=\frac{1}{2}\) and passes through \((2,5)\).
Point - slope formula: \(y - y_1=m(x - x_1)\) (where \((x_1,y_1)=(2,5)\)).
Substitute: \(y - 5=\frac{1}{2}(x - 2)\).

Step3: Simplify to slope - intercept form (optional, but common)

Distribute \(\frac{1}{2}\): \(y - 5=\frac{1}{2}x-1\).
Add 5 to both sides: \(y=\frac{1}{2}x + 4\).
(Or in standard form: \(x-2y=-8\), but slope - intercept is also correct.)

Answer:

The equation of the line is \(y=\frac{1}{2}x + 4\) (or equivalent forms like \(x - 2y=-8\) or \(y - 5=\frac{1}{2}(x - 2)\)).
